Ramsey Hospital President Rides For MS To Honor Mom RAMSEY, N.J. -- The community is invited to join Ramsey resident and Overlook Medical Center President Alan Lieber in the Bike MS Country Challenge Sept. 17 and 18. Lieber's mother, Thelma Lieber of River Vale, is afflicted with MS. Every year, he does personal fund-raising, rallies a team, and rides 100 miles with his wife for the two-day event through Morris and Somerset counties.  He started Team Atlantic Health System. Bloomingdale Firefighers Need Cool Vehicles For 'Cruise Night' BLOOMINGDALE, N.J. -- Car enthusiasts are invited to show their wheels at the 3rd Annual Firefighter Bob Kochka Cruise Night on Friday, Sept. 23 in Bloomingdale.The benefit event runs 5-9:30 p.m. at Walter T. Bergen School and is sponsored by the Bloomingdale Fire Department in memory of firefighter Bob Kochka who lost his battle to Pancreatic Cancer in 2013. Proceeds benefit the Lustgarten Foundation for Pancreatic Cancer Research. Professor Lays Out Science Of Climate Change At Teaneck Forum TEANECK, N.J. -- The fall season opens at the Puffin Educational Forum in Teaneck with a series of presentations about climate change. Professor Philip Penner will speak at noon on Tuesday, Sept. 20, Tuesday, Sept. 27 and Wednesday, Oct. 5. A light lunch will be included. Penner is Professor Emeritus in the Department of Science at the Borough of Manhattan Community College, The City University of New York. Southern Westchester Boces Take On Restoration Of 9/11 Mural GREENBURGH, N.Y. -- A 9/11 mural created by Westchester County artists will be restored and maintained thanks to an initiative with Southern Westchester BOCES/Center for Career Services. The large mural with over 1,500 individually handpainted tiles was constructed at Richard Presser Park on Central Avenue (Webb Field), but hasn't held up, likely due to changing weather conditions.  The town of Greenburgh, Fairview, Hartsdale and Greenville Fire departments have held annual 9/11 ceremonies at the wall, including a well-attended event on Sunday.
